It doesn't appear to be an "artificial island," and I'm unaware what the terminology would be for "island" in a wetlands environment prone to flooding. My mistake; I was in error.
It doesn't appear to be an "artificial island," and I'm unaware what the terminology would be for "island" in a wetlands environment prone to flooding. My mistake; I was in error.
No replies